Transaction 3768a630304762146f1314682eeaec758abfc867aa2205d513188f558261f740
1 Input
1 Output
-
3768a630304762146f1314682eeaec758abfc867aa2205d513188f558261f740:0
- value
- 1564
- script pubkey
- OP_0 OP_PUSHBYTES_20 91bb001b23ae373db9708ae1c05d99e66a30946e
- address
- bc1qjxasqxer4cmnmwts3tsuqhveue4rp9rwqq473y